Output 65f7fe60a7934e551c88af24402108a82e36adc71ec876f69beea18257429b31:1

value
2544613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c7f01d7f72a89ced2ac6e909b90dc0f76e658e7 OP_EQUAL
address
38fVRjkgfPLTQWgN2tn6NE5AgwZkffvs8g
transaction
65f7fe60a7934e551c88af24402108a82e36adc71ec876f69beea18257429b31
spent
true